Using the formula A=P(1+r/n) ^nt calculate the value of an initial investment of $4,500 after 10 years at 4% interest, compounde

d quarterly (four times per year).
Mathematics
1 answer:
Tema [17]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Using the formula provided, the value of that investment after 10 years is

A = P(1 + r/n) ^nt

   = 4500 x (1 + (4/100)/4)^(10 x 4)

   = 4500 x (1.01)^40

   = 6699.89$

La suma de dos números es 14 añadiendo 1 al mayor se obtiene el doble del menor cuáles son los dos números. si puede ser explica
elena-s [515]

Answer:

The two numbers are 9 and 5.

Step-by-step explanation:

The question is:

The sum of two numbers is 14, adding 1 to the greatest gives twice the smallest which are the two numbers. if it can be explained please

Solution:

Denote the two numbers by <em>x</em> and <em>y</em>.

It is provided that:

x+y=14...(i)

Also,

x+1=2y\\\Rightarrow x-2y=-1...(ii)

Solve the equations (i) and (ii) by the substitution method as follows:

In equation (ii) substitute <em>x</em> = 14 - y and solve for <em>y</em>:

x-2y=-1\\14-y-2y=-1\\-3y=-1-14\\-3y=-15\\y=5

Substitute <em>y</em> in equation (i) and solve for <em>x</em> as follows:

x+y=14\\x+5=14\\x=14-5\\x=9

Thus, the two numbers are 9 and 5.
